"Help" script pain in the neck

Featured Replies

OK, I've got the "Help" script, and since each subsidiary file is programmed to open the main file (hidden), I can now get the "Help" menu item everywhere.

The problem is, once I use the "Help" menu item once, it disappears. The only way to get it back is to quit the bound solution completely and reopen it.

Am I missing something, or did the FMP Developer programmers screw up?

The Help will disappear from the Menu item if the main file is closed. You need to keep the main file open at all times.
